Use this plugin with cause. http://online.securityfocus.com/archive/1/147562 Cisco Systems info at cisco dot com http://www.cisco.com Cisco 645 Other Cisco and network devices Denial Of Service The Cisco 675 is vulnerable to a remote Denial of Service attack. An attacker may crash the device by sending the HTTP request "GET ?" to the HTTP port tcp/80 of the router. You need to reboot the device to make it work again. Upgrade your Cisco firmware and filter incoming traffic on port tcp/80.
